色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

jquery++縮略圖切換

錢諍諍1年前8瀏覽0評論
在前端開發中,我們經常會遇到需要展示大量圖片的情況,這時候制作縮略圖可以讓頁面變得更加美觀和易于瀏覽。而對于縮略圖的切換,使用jQuery++插件可以方便快捷地實現。 首先,在HTML文件中引入jQuery和jQuery++的庫文件:
<script src="https://code.jquery.com/jquery-3.5.1.min.js"></script>
<script src="https://cdn.jsdelivr.net/npm/jquery-plusplus/dist/jquery-plusplus.min.js"></script>
接下來,我們需要在HTML文件中添加圖片和對應的縮略圖。例如:
<div id="gallery">
<img src="images/pic1.jpg">
<img src="images/pic2.jpg">
<img src="images/pic3.jpg">
</div>
<div id="thumbnails">
<img src="images/pic1-thumb.jpg">
<img src="images/pic2-thumb.jpg">
<img src="images/pic3-thumb.jpg">
</div>
在jQuery++中,我們可以使用`$.fn.on()`方法來監聽縮略圖的點擊事件,然后在回調函數中切換對應的大圖。代碼如下:
$(function() {
$('#thumbnails img').on('click', function() {
var $img = $(this),
$gallery = $('#gallery'),
$galleryImg = $gallery.find('img'),
newSrc = $img.attr('src').replace('-thumb', '');
$galleryImg.fadeOut(400, function() {
$(this).attr('src', newSrc).fadeIn();
});
});
});
以上代碼中,我們首先獲取點擊的縮略圖和對應的大圖容器。然后,我們將縮略圖的路徑中的`-thumb`替換為空串,以獲取對應的大圖路徑。接著,我們使用`fadeIn()`和`fadeOut()`方法,以漸變的方式切換大圖的顯示。 通過以上代碼,我們就可以實現縮略圖與大圖之間的無縫切換。同時,由于jQuery++庫提供了更加便捷的API和方法,我們的代碼也更加簡潔易懂。